Cetyl PEG/PPG-10/1 Dimethicone is a clear to hazy, colorless to straw liquid. It is a polysiloxane polyalkyl polyether block copolymer designed for use as a silicone emulsifier for water-in-oil emulsions.

The chemical structure of Cetyl PEG/PPG-10/1 Dimethicone allows the incorporation of ingredients that would typically destabilize the emulsion. It is a potent water-in-oil emulsifier used in creams, lotions, and other personal care products. 

In addition, Cetyl PEG/PPG-10/1 Dimethicone may be used as a co-emulsifier in oil-in-water emulsions. It enables cold process manufacturing and emulsification for complex water-oil-water (W/O/W) systems.

Cetyl PEG/PPG-10/1 Dimethicone is used in various personal care formulations, and the required amounts depend on the type of application. It can be diluted with cool water and lower alcohols. It also aids the emulsification of paraffin and silicone fluids, fatty acid esters, and vegetable triglycerides (some of which are difficult to emulsify).

Cetyl PEG/PPG-10/1 Dimethicone is basically non-hazardous and has a very low order of toxicity, although contact with the skin or with the eyes may cause irritation.
